What are the typical salary ranges by seniority for Continuous Improvement roles?
Associate Continuous Improvement Analyst: $60,000–$80,000 annually. Mid‑level Engineer: $80,000–$110,000. Senior Manager: $110,000–$150,000. Director or VP of Continuous Improvement: $150,000–$200,000+, depending on industry and location.
Which skills and certifications are required for a career in Continuous Improvement?
Lean Six Sigma Green or Black Belt, DMAIC mastery, Kaizen facilitation, 5S implementation, Minitab or JMP statistical analysis, Tableau/Power BI dashboarding, process mapping, root cause analysis, statistical process control, APICS CPIM or CSCP, ISO 9001 lead auditor, Agile or Scrum experience for Lean IT projects, and familiarity with lean manufacturing or service processes.
Is remote work available for Continuous Improvement positions?
Many Continuous Improvement Analyst and Engineer roles are hybrid or fully remote because data analysis, dashboard creation, and process design can be done from any location. However, on‑site Kaizen events, audit visits, or plant‑level process changes usually require periodic travel. Companies offering 100% remote roles often provide virtual simulation tools and remote audit platforms.
What does the career progression path look like in Continuous Improvement?
Typical ladder: Continuous Improvement Analyst → Process Engineer → Continuous Improvement Manager → Director of Continuous Improvement → VP of Operations/Continuous Improvement → Chief Improvement Officer. Advancement is driven by proven DMAIC project outcomes, leadership of cross‑functional teams, and strategic alignment with business goals.
What are the current industry trends affecting Continuous Improvement?
Digital transformation is pushing Continuous Improvement into AI‑driven predictive maintenance, machine learning for quality forecasting, and real‑time KPI dashboards. Sustainability initiatives demand waste‑reduction metrics, circular‑economy process mapping, and green‑lean strategies. Industry 4.0, DevOps, and agile release pipelines are integrating Lean principles into software delivery and product development.
